(SEAL) Jane Kelly Stoll Jane Kelly Stoll, Deputy City Clerk ---PAGE BREAK--- ORDINANCE NUMBER 3308 AN ORDINANCE OF THE MISSOULA CITY COUNCIL PERTAINING TO THE MODIFICATION TO THE MISSOULA URBAN RENEWAL PLAN FOR URBAN RENEWAL DISTRICT II TO INCLUDE ADDITIONAL PROPERTY BY ADJUSTING THE DISTRICT BOUNDARIES AND BY AMENDING ORDINANCE 2803 TO REFLECT THE ADJUSTED DISTRICT BOUNDARIES BE IT ORDAINED by the City Council (the “Council”) of the City of Missoula, Montana (the “City”) as follows: Section 1. Recitals. 1.01. On December 16, 1991, the Council created Urban Renewal District II and Urban Renewal District III and an urban renewal plan therefor (the “Plan”) through Ordinance 2803, which was amended to include additional area on July 22, 2002 pursuant to City Council Resolution 6533 and Ordinance 3215. 1.02. On November 28, 2005, the Council adopted Resolution No. 6993, A Resolution Declaring A Blighted Area in Need of Redevelopment and Rehabilitation Exists within the City of Missoula, Montana, and to Determine the Boundaries of that Area. There are several parcels of land adjacent to Urban Renewal District II that meet the conditions of blight defined in Section 7-15-4206(2), M.C.A. Such Resolution No. 6993, determined the boundaries of the Area and declared that rehabilitation and redevelopment of the Area is necessary and desirable in the interest of the public health, safety, and welfare of the residents of Missoula, pursuant to 7-15-4210 M.C.A. 1.03. On December 12, 2005, the Council held a public hearing on the proposed modification to the Urban Renewal Plan for Urban Renewal District II to include the Area within the boundaries of the District. Such hearing was preceded by actual notice mailed prior to December 4, 2005 to the persons whose names appear on the county treasurer's tax roll as the owners of property in the Area, and by publication published December 4, 2005 and December 11, 2005 as required by Section 7-15-4215, M.C.A. and the Urban Renewal Plan for Urban Renewal District II. All persons appearing at the hearing were given an opportunity to speak. Section 2. Finding of Blight. The Council hereby confirms that the property described below is blighted within the meaning of Section 7-15-4206(A), M.C.A.: Lots 1 to 19 in Block 9 of Sunnyside Addition to the City of Missoula, Montana, according to the official map or plat thereof on file and of record in the office of the County Clerk and Recorder of Missoula County, Montana as recorded in Book 1 of Plats at Page 88; and, All of Block 18 of Sunnyside Addition to the City of Missoula, lying West of the right-of- way line of the Northern Pacific Railway Company which includes: Fraction of Lots 2 and 3, all of Lots 4 thru 10, and fraction of Lots 11 and 12 of said Block 18 of Sunnyside Addition as recorded in Book 1 of Plats at Page 88 and depicted in Exhibit A hereto and, That portion of Montana Street lying west of the right of way line of the Montana Rail Link Bitterroot Branch and, that portion of Walnut Street lying between the center line of Montana Street and the extended south right of way line of Dakota Street and, that portion of Wyoming Street lying west of the right of way line of the Montana Rail Link Bitterroot Branch and, that portion of Dakota Street lying west of the right of way line of the Montana Rail Link Bitterroot Branch and, a portion of Hickory Street lying between the center line of Montana Street and the west right of way line of the Montana Rail Link. ---PAGE BREAK--- Section 3. Modification of the Urban Renewal District II Boundaries. The Council hereby modifies the boundaries of Urban Renewal District I as defined by Ordinance 2803 and Resolution 5210 are hereby amended to include the generally described herein and as set forth in Exhibit A to this Ordinance (the “Area”). Section 4. Conformity with the Plan. The Area included into Urban Renewal District II pursuant to this Ordinance is comparable to adjacent contiguous land within the original boundaries of Urban Renewal District II, and the redevelopment thereof is consistent with the Plan, the Comprehensive Plan, and the City’s Growth Plan. [The Area shall be considered part of the “County Lands Sub-Area” within the Urban Renewal Plan for Urban Renewal District II. All goals, objectives, and statements within the Urban Renewal Plan for Urban Renewal District II regarding that Sub-Area shall hereinafter include the area identified and described pursuant to this Ordinance.] Section 5. Tax Increment Provision. The Urban Renewal Plan for Urban Renewal District II contains a provision for the use of tax increment financing (TIF) district. The TIF district for Urban Renewal District II shall be expanded to include all properties within the modified boundary and be administered pursuant to Section 7-15-4282 through 7-15-4292 M.C.A.
